Understanding the Role of Slitting Line Machines in Metal Processing

Slitting line machines play a pivotal role in the manufacturing and processing of metal sheets. These machines are designed to cut large coils of metal into narrower strips, optimizing material usage and enhancing efficiency in production lines. The slitting process involves unwinding a coil, feeding it through a series of blades, and then recoiling the cut strips into manageable rolls. This operation is crucial in industries where precise metal dimensions are essential for subsequent manufacturing processes.
The primary components of a slitting line machine include uncoiler, slitter, tensioning system, and recoiler. The uncoiler is responsible for holding the metal coil and feeding it into the slitting section. The slitter consists of multiple circular blades that can be adjusted according to the required strip width. An effective tensioning system ensures that the metal is fed through the slitter at the right speed and tension, preventing any deformation or defects. Finally, the recoiler gathers the finished strips onto a spool for easy handling and transportation.
One of the significant advantages of using slitting line machines is their ability to enhance production efficiency. These machines can operate at high speeds, allowing manufacturers to process large volumes of metal in a shorter period. Additionally, they provide superior accuracy in cutting, minimizing waste and ensuring that each strip meets the specified dimensions. This precision is vital in industries such as automotive, construction, and appliance manufacturing, where tolerances are critical.
Furthermore, modern slitting line machines are equipped with advanced technologies that improve overall functionality. Features such as automatic blade height adjustment, digital control panels, and real-time monitoring systems contribute to increased operational efficiency and reduced downtime. These innovations not only streamline the cutting process but also enhance safety for operators by minimizing manual intervention.
The versatility of slitting line machines allows them to process various types of metals, including steel, aluminum, and copper. This adaptability makes them invaluable in diverse sectors, extending from heavy industries to light manufacturing. Companies can customize slitting lines according to their specific needs, ensuring that they can meet the demands of their production requirements efficiently.
